The best and worst of marrying in Isle of Skye
Main advantages
- Fantasy geological landscapes (Quiraing, Old Man of Storr) providing the world's most spectacular elopement backdrop.
- Atmosphere of total romantic isolation and deep connection with wild nature.
- Very progressive Scottish marriage laws allowing legal civil and humanist weddings anywhere outdoors.
Points to keep in mind
- Long distances and complex logistics for large groups; the nearest airport (Inverness) is almost 3 hours away.
- Extremely strong winds and severe weather unpredictability even in summer.

Top Venues in Isle of Skye
Dunvegan Castle & Gardens
The oldest continuously inhabited castle in Scotland, seat of Clan MacLeod, surrounded by beautiful gardens and the sea.
Fairy Pools (Outdoor Ceremony)
Crystal-clear rock pools fed by waterfalls under the Cuillin mountains.
Flodigarry Hotel
A historic country house hotel with incomparable views of the Trotternish Peninsula, ideal for intimate luxury weddings.
Wedding traditions in United Kingdom
What a local guest expects to see on the wedding day.
Something old, new, borrowed, blue
The bride wears something old (continuity), new (optimism), borrowed (shared happiness) and blue (fidelity). An iconic British tradition.
The wedding breakfast
British peculiarity: the wedding breakfast is NOT breakfast — it's the main meal after the ceremony, usually at midday or early afternoon.
Bridesmaids and best man
Bridesmaids all wear matching dresses (colour chosen by the bride). The best man delivers the key speech during the wedding breakfast.
The cake cutting
Multi-tier fondant-iced wedding cake. Cutting it together remains the official photo moment of the event.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is it possible to get married legally outdoors in Skye?
Yes, in Scotland you can legally marry outdoors anywhere you choose, as long as your celebrant (civil, religious, or humanist) is registered.
How much does an elopement in the Isle of Skye cost?
An intimate elopement (just the couple plus photographer/officiant) can be done for under 5,000€ including accommodation and a premium photographer. A small wedding (20-30 guests) at a country house typically costs between 12,000€ and 20,000€.
How do you get to the Isle of Skye?
There are no direct flights. Most couples fly into Edinburgh or Glasgow, rent a car, and drive about 4.5 hours through the spectacular Highlands to cross the Skye Bridge.
